Quantum optical cooling of nanoparticles
One important requirement to see quantum effects is to remove all thermal energy from the particle motion, i.e. to cool it as close as possible to absolute zero temperature. Researchers are now one step closer to reaching this goal by demonstrating a new method for cooling levitated nanoparticles.

66-million-year-old deathbed linked to dinosaur-killing meteor
Paleontologists have found a fossil site in North Dakota that contains animals and plants killed and buried within an hour of the meteor impact that killed the dinosaurs 66 million years ago. This is the richest K-T boundary site ever found, incorporating insects, fish, mammals, dinosaurs and plants living at the end of the Cretaceous, mixed with tektites and rock created and scattered by the impact. The find shows that dinosaurs survived until the impact.

Biophysicists use machine learning to understand, predict dynamics of worm behavior
Biophysicists have used an automated method to model a living system -- the dynamics of a worm perceiving and escaping pain. The model makes accurate predictions about the dynamics of the worm behavior, and these predictions are biologically interpretable and have been experimentally verified.

Researchers discover the source of new neurons in brain's hippocampus
Researchers have shown, in mice, that one type of stem cell that makes adult neurons is the source of this lifetime stock of new cells in the hippocampus. These findings may help neuroscientists figure out how to maintain youthful conditions for learning and memory, and repair and regenerate parts of the brain after injury and aging.

Seeds inherit memories from their mother
Seeds remain in a dormant state as long as environmental conditions are not ideal for germination. The depth of this sleep is inherited from their mother. Researchers reveal how this maternal imprint is transmitted through fragments of 'interfering' RNAs, which inactivate genes, and that a similar mechanism enables to transmit another imprint, that of the temperatures present during the development of the seed. This mechanism allows the seed to optimize the timing of its germination.

Five new frog species from Madagascar
Scientists have named five new species of frogs found across the island of Madagascar. The largest could sit on your thumbnail, the smallest is hardly longer than a grain of rice.

Saturn's rings coat tiny moons
New findings have emerged about five tiny moons nestled in and near Saturn's rings. The closest-ever flybys by NASA's Cassini spacecraft reveal that the surfaces of these unusual moons are covered with material from the planet's rings -- and from icy particles blasting out of Saturn's larger moon Enceladus. The work paints a picture of the competing processes shaping these mini-moons.

Galápagos islands have nearly 10 times more alien marine species than once thought
Over 50 non-native species have found their way to the Galápagos Islands, almost 10 times more than scientists previously thought, reports a new study.

The Serengeti-Mara squeeze -- One of the world's most iconic ecosystems under pressure
Increased human activity around one of Africa's most iconic ecosystems is 'squeezing the wildlife in its core', damaging habitation and disrupting the migration routes of wildebeest, zebra and gazelle, an international study has concluded.

Deep groundwater may generate surface streams on Mars
New research suggests that deep groundwater could still be active on Mars and could originate surface streams in some near-equatorial areas on Mars.

Designer organelles bring new functionalities into cells
For the first time, scientists have engineered the complex biological process of translation into a designer organelle in a living mammalian cell. Researchers used this technique to create a membraneless organelle that can build proteins from natural and synthetic amino acids carrying new functionality.

Mass amphibian extinctions globally caused by fungal disease
An international study has found a fungal disease has caused dramatic population declines in more than 500 amphibian species, including 90 extinctions, over the past 50 years.
